Preheat oven to 375°. Place the tilapia into a 9x13 baking dish, then sprinkle the salt, paprika and pepper overtop. Whisk the butter, lemon juice and garlic together in a small bowl, then pour it over the tilapia. Put the lemon slices over and under the tilapia.
